Description
Pre-Columbian, Southern Mexico to Guatemala, Maya, Late Classic Period, ca. 500 to 700 CE. A large buff-brown pottery conch shell decorated with an openwork design consisting of three openwork roundels surrounded with an openwork geometric pattern. Some remaining ochre and white surface pigment. A nice example. Size: 9.5" L (24.1 cm).

Published and exhibited: Ceremonial Objects of Ancient Mexico, Memphis Pink Palace Museum, 1984, #58.

Provenance: private New York, New York, USA collection; ex private Nevada, USA collection; ex Dr. David Harner collection, Arkansas, USA, from the 1950s-1960s, Collection # PM34.
